Output 90af270fce712c93cfa9b3eb55dd30809f6cd2e8a466480519d3f8d0ade671fd:1

value
2840696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dacc948119582c9789f713ffea1a29d5646b4ee9 OP_EQUAL
address
3MdvJqVqXeEvgwAJztorNvtdg2AJJjf79A
transaction
90af270fce712c93cfa9b3eb55dd30809f6cd2e8a466480519d3f8d0ade671fd
spent
true